Samsung Electronics executives received 300 billion won in the third quarter of this year

[Alpha Biz=(Chicago) Reporter Kim Jisun] Samsung Electronics paid executives nearly 300 billion won in long-term performance benefits by the third quarter of this year.

According to Samsung Electronics' quarterly report on the 21st, the accumulated amount of long-term incentives paid for executives in the third quarter of this year was 259.241 billion won on a consolidated basis.

As of the third quarter, Samsung Electronics had 1,156 unregistered executives and five registered executives, excluding outside directors. In a simple calculation, each executive received at least 220 million won in bonuses. The actual amount of money received may vary because it is paid differently depending on individual performance and not received by executives for less than three years.

Through the contract in the third quarter of this year, the provisions accumulated to spend long-term incentives in the future were 389.97 billion won. Samsung Electronics said it will appropriate the amount of money that is expected to be paid in the future as appropriation debt.
